Assignment:

In GSM cellular phone newtworks, the cells covering wide open environments are approximately circular with a maximum radius of 35 km. Assume the propagation speed of the waves in air to be c = 3 · 108 m/s. Consider a terminal randomly placed within such a cell, so that with x and y the spatial coordinates of the terminal with respect to the base station, the PDF of the rve x = [x, y] is constant within a circle centered at the origin and having a radius of 35 km, and zero outside.

a) Write the expression of px (a1, a2).

b) Find the PDF of the distance r between terminal and base station.

c) With τ the propagation delay over the distance r, find mτ, σ2τ and P[τ > mτ].
